Epic Baguette is a French bakery located in Westminster, CA, offering a delectable selection of French baguettes and pastries.
With their online ordering system, customers can conveniently order their favorite food from Epic Baguette and experience the amazingly delicious flavors of French cuisine.
Generated from the website